WebAnonymous saying. Eye contact is an important aspect of non-verbal behaviour. In interpersonal interaction, it serves three main purposes: 1. To give and receive feedback. Looking at someone lets them know that the receiver is concentrating on the content of their speech. Not maintaining eye contact can indicate disinterest.
